airbags · filed 12/05/2016

T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2013 HYUNDAI GENESIS. WHILE DRIVING, THE PASSENGER SIDE AIR BAG DEPLOYED WITHOUT WARNING AND CAUSED THE VEHICLE TO CRASH INTO A POLE. THE CONTACT DID NOT PROVIDE ANY SPECIFIC DETAILS ABOUT THE CRASH.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T DIAGNOSED OR REPAIRED. THE VIN WAS INCLUDED IN N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 16V722000 (AIR BAGS).
